Output 62f3665ec4f9b3bc9dec1026bbee4e0f44d988a119176dffb9024431b20dfe89:1

value
17303040
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9561fd7fb777ca4b46be5a246f3497e6307e6aed OP_EQUALVERIFY OP_CHECKSIG
address
1Ecs54fs9DeSGhksKmgAtWNVoRUN85CNuE
transaction
62f3665ec4f9b3bc9dec1026bbee4e0f44d988a119176dffb9024431b20dfe89
spent
true